Occurrences of the Langille Surname

The Langille surname is most commonly found in Canada, with a total incidence of 4633. This suggests that there is a significant population of Langilles living in Canada, where the surname has likely been passed down through generations.

In the United States, the Langille surname is less common, with an incidence of 1209. However, there are still many individuals with the surname Langille living in the US, particularly in states with large Canadian populations such as Maine and Vermont.

In Australia, the Langille surname is quite rare, with an incidence of only 13. This suggests that there are only a few individuals with the surname Langille living in Australia, possibly as a result of migration from Canada or the UK.

In other countries such as England, Norway, and the United Arab Emirates, the Langille surname is even less common, with an incidence of 5, 3, and 2 respectively. This indicates that the Langille surname is most prevalent in Canada and the US, with smaller populations in other countries around the world.
